Minutes — Management Meeting

Prepared for the incoming director. Topic: possible acquisition of Greyfen Analytics. Due diligence 70% complete. Valuation gap remains; Greyfen seeks a premium. Integration risks flagged by Ops. Decision deferred to next month. Talla Nyberg leads negotiations. Our walk-away position is stated below.

board note of fawig-kagup: Only 48 of the 435 pilot accounts renewed Rusion, so a churn review is set for September 12. Fenwynox Logistics is in early talks to buy Sorielek Systems for about $117.8 million.

Hey, welcome to the rotation! Quick intro to Deploybird, our chat bot: it posts rollout status to the release channel and answers "status" queries per service. If it goes quiet, it's usually the webhook relay — restart fixes it nine times out of ten. Commands, restart steps, and known quirks are all documented on this page.

dashboard of kafop-yagep = https://jira.zemvarsys.internal/pages/pages/pages/display/cc87

14:22 — The Murkwater team completed the broker upgrade from Relaybird 3 to 4 on the staging tier. Plugin authors should note that acknowledgement semantics changed, causing duplicate deliveries for roughly nine minutes. All staging artifacts from this window were rebuilt and re-signed. The rebuilt release carries the token below.

pipeline stamp: htk9_ce63042d9

Subject: Read-replica lag alarm — heads up

Welcome to the rotation. The Fennelwick replica-lag alarm fires when the Quarrystone cluster falls more than 90 seconds behind primary. Usually it's a long-running analytics query from the Larkhollow batch jobs. Kill the offending query, confirm lag drains, then ack. Don't fail over unless lag exceeds 15 minutes and keeps climbing. Escalate to Priya's team if the binlog position stalls entirely. Full triage steps live on the internal runbook page.

operations page: https://jira.qorvelsys.internal/browse/pages/browse/pages

Recovery notes for Bellchime, the school timetable solver. If a planner gets locked out mid-term, things get loud fast, so move quick. Confirm their district through the Harrowgate admin console, then reset from the Accounts tab — solver jobs keep running, nothing is lost. If the admin console itself won't let you in, fall back to the emergency passphrase listed right under this paragraph.

vault phrase of tajop-haduf = holath-brivan-wenax